Transaction 8c39a259f549876671961ff615979caeb76b8fd6d0c40d7725977807cbddce2f

2 Input
2 Outputs
  • 8c39a259f549876671961ff615979caeb76b8fd6d0c40d7725977807cbddce2f:0
  • value  17579128
    address  19xmLK2VC3Ewriidp99fxn462b1ZpDdAWj
  • 8c39a259f549876671961ff615979caeb76b8fd6d0c40d7725977807cbddce2f:1
  • value  182410872
    address  1Lw6FnzxY6VF7QmjXvGi4DM8zfdkbL4gBJ